Abstract
Through using the self-beat of fiber delay method, we measured the short-term frequency stability of Tm, Ho:YLF microchip laser cooled by liquid nitrogen. When the single longitudinal mode output laser power is 10 mW and the delayed fiber length is 100 m, 200 m, 300 m, 400 m and 500 m (delayed time ranging from 0.5-2.5 μs), respectively, the short-term frequency stability linearly increase from 1.5-4.75 kHz, and the linear slope coefficient is 1.48 kHz/μS. The oscilloscope's Fourier integral time is about 40 ms, when the stability is measured. The laser can be the signal source for 2μm frequency stabilized laser.
